Premises liability is a distinct area of personal injury law that makes landowners accountable when their lack of proper care results in physical harm. A premises liability lawyer works across situations involving public and private properties across the board. The foundation of these cases can be complex, which is why working with an attorney is so important.

These cases demand that the injured party demonstrate several key elements: that the defendant owned or controlled the property, that a hazardous condition existed, that the owner was aware or reasonably should have been aware about it, and that the danger was the direct reason for your harm. What if I was partially at fault for my accident — can I still recover?

Nevada uses a comparative negligence standard. Under this rule, you can still recover damages as long as your share of fault does not exceed 50%. The amount you recover is lowered by your percentage of fault. A premises liability lawyer works to limit any responsibility placed on your shoulders during negotiations or trial.

What is the statute of limitations for premises liability claims in Nevada?

Under Nevada law, personal injury lawsuits of this type must be initiated within a two-year window from the time of the incident. Missing this deadline usually eliminates your right to sue. What am I entitled to if I win a premises liability case?

Injured property visitors may be entitled to a range of damages. This generally covers all hospital bills, therapy costs, and anticipated future treatment, all work-related financial losses, the non-economic harm you have endured, and additional losses tied to your situation. In instances of willful or wanton negligence, courts may award additional punishment-based damages.
